The world is rapidly changing, and Artificial Intelligence (AI) is at the forefront of this revolution. But becoming an “AI expert” can seem daunting, requiring years of study in complex fields like machine learning and deep neural networks. What if there was one core skill that could significantly elevate your understanding and ability to work with AI, regardless of your technical background? That skill is Prompt Engineering.
What is Prompt Engineering?
Prompt engineering is the art and science of designing effective prompts to elicit desired responses from AI models, particularly large language models (LLMs) like GPT-3, Bard, and LLaMA. Think of it as learning how to talk to AI. Instead of just asking a simple question, you learn to structure your input in a way that unlocks the full potential of the model.

Image depicting a person crafting a well-structured prompt that leads to a desired AI output.
Why is Prompt Engineering So Important?
Here’s why prompt engineering is quickly becoming an essential skill for anyone working with or interested in AI:
- Unlock Hidden Potential: LLMs are incredibly powerful, but their output depends heavily on the quality of the input. A well-crafted prompt can unlock hidden capabilities and generate surprisingly insightful and creative results.
- Reduce Bias and Inaccuracies: Poorly worded prompts can lead to biased or inaccurate responses. Prompt engineering helps you mitigate these issues by guiding the AI towards more objective and reliable outputs.
- Efficiency and Cost-Effectiveness: With effective prompts, you can achieve your desired results with fewer API calls, saving time and money.
- Accessible to All Skill Levels: You don’t need a PhD in computer science to learn prompt engineering. While a deeper understanding of AI models helps, the core principles can be grasped and applied by anyone.
- Wide Range of Applications: From content creation and code generation to data analysis and customer service, prompt engineering can be applied to a vast array of tasks.
Key Principles of Prompt Engineering
While prompt engineering is a developing field, some core principles are emerging:
- Be Clear and Specific: Avoid ambiguity and provide the AI with all the necessary context to understand your request.
- Define the Format: Specify the desired format of the output (e.g., a list, a paragraph, a code snippet).
- Provide Examples: Show the AI what you’re looking for by providing examples of ideal outputs.
- Use Constraints: Impose limitations to guide the AI’s response (e.g., “Keep the response under 100 words”).
- Iterate and Experiment: Prompt engineering is an iterative process. Experiment with different prompts and refine them based on the results you get.
How to Get Started with Prompt Engineering
The best way to learn prompt engineering is to experiment! Here are some resources to get you started:
- Online Courses: Platforms like Coursera, Udemy, and edX offer courses specifically on prompt engineering.
- Community Forums: Engage with other prompt engineers on platforms like Reddit and Discord to share tips and learn from each other.
- Official Documentation: Explore the documentation provided by the developers of various LLMs (e.g., OpenAI, Google AI).
- Practice, Practice, Practice: Use available AI tools and practice crafting prompts for different tasks.
The Future is Prompt Engineering
As AI continues to evolve, prompt engineering will become even more crucial. Mastering this skill will not only make you more effective in your current role but also open up new opportunities in the rapidly growing field of AI. So, start experimenting, start learning, and start becoming an AI expert, one prompt at a time!
